Wei Jin is a scholar working on Computer Vision and Pattern Recognition, Media Technology and Ecology. According to data from OpenAlex, Wei Jin has authored 64 papers receiving a total of 540 indexed citations (citations by other indexed papers that have themselves been cited), including 35 papers in Computer Vision and Pattern Recognition, 24 papers in Media Technology and 6 papers in Ecology. Recurrent topics in Wei Jin's work include Advanced Image Fusion Techniques (15 papers), Remote-Sensing Image Classification (12 papers) and Image and Signal Denoising Methods (7 papers). Wei Jin is often cited by papers focused on Advanced Image Fusion Techniques (15 papers), Remote-Sensing Image Classification (12 papers) and Image and Signal Denoising Methods (7 papers). Wei Jin collaborates with scholars based in China, United States and Australia. Wei Jin's co-authors include Randi Fu, Biao Wei, Peng Feng, Yaxun Zhou, Feng Shao, Xiangchao Meng, Jinlai Zhang, Yanmei Meng, Yi-Je Lim and Suvranu De and has published in prestigious journals such as Expert Systems with Applications, IEEE Access and Sensors.
